
Tomato Pear drops Seeds - Grow Sweet and Flavorful Pear drops Tomatoes in Your Garden
Discover the charm of Pear Drops Tomato Seeds, a delightful cherry-type tomato variety known for its sweet flavor, golden color, and high productivity. Perfect for container gardens, patios, or vegetable beds, this compact tomato produces clusters of small, pear-shaped fruits that are both decorative and delicious. Ideal for fresh snacking, salads, or garnishes.

Specifications:
- Seed Type: Non-GMO, heirloom, high-quality seeds
- Planting Season: Spring to early summer
- USDA Zones: 3–11 (annual)
- Sun Exposure: Full sun (6–8 hours daily)
- Soil Type: Well-drained, nutrient-rich loam with pH 6.0–6.8
- Planting Depth: 0.25 inch (6 mm)
- Spacing: 18–24 inches (45–60 cm)
- Germination Time: 7–14 days
- Days to Maturity: 75–80 days from transplant
- Plant Height: 3–4 feet (90–120 cm)
- Watering: Keep soil moist but not soggy
- Indoor/Outdoor: Start indoors 6–8 weeks before last frost; transplant after frost danger has passed
Planting Guide:
- Sow seeds indoors in seed trays with quality potting mix.
- Maintain soil temperature between 70–80°F (21–27°C) for germination.
- Transplant seedlings when they reach 6–8 inches tall.
- Choose a sunny, sheltered location with well-drained soil.
- Water consistently and provide staking or cages for support.
- Harvest when fruits are fully yellow and slightly soft to touch.
